Understanding Double Brick Wall Ties An Essential Component in Construction In the realm of construction and architecture, the integrity of a building relies heavily on its structural components. One such vital component is the wall tie, specifically in the context of double brick walls. This article delves into the importance, functionality, and considerations associated with double brick wall ties, providing a comprehensive overview for both professionals and enthusiasts in the field. The Structure of Double Brick Walls Double brick walls, often referred to as cavity walls, consist of two layers of bricks with a gap (or cavity) in between. This construction technique provides several benefits, including improved insulation, moisture control, and structural stability. However, without appropriate ties, the two layers of bricks can become independent of each other, undermining the overall strength and durability of the wall. What Are Wall Ties? Wall ties are metal or plastic fixtures used to connect the two layers of a double brick wall. They play a critical role in maintaining the structural integrity of the wall by ensuring that both layers work together as a unified entity. Wall ties help to resist lateral forces such as wind pressure, prevent movement due to thermal expansion, and help in transferring loads between the inner and outer walls. Types of Wall Ties There are various types of wall ties designed for different applications and conditions . The most common types include 1. Steel Wall Ties Typically made from stainless or galvanised steel, these ties are renowned for their strength and durability. They are commonly used in load-bearing applications. 2. Plastic Wall Ties These ties are lightweight, corrosion-resistant, and ideal for areas susceptible to moisture. They are often used where steel ties may degrade over time. 3. Restraint Ties These are specialized ties that help to secure the wall to another structural element, such as a roof or floor. 4. Cavity Wall Ties Specifically designed for cavity walls, these ties ensure that both the inner and outer bricks are held securely together across the cavity distance. double brick wall ties Key Considerations When Installing Wall Ties The installation of wall ties must adhere to strict guidelines to ensure safety and efficacy. Here are some critical factors to consider 1. Spacing and Placement Proper spacing of wall ties is crucial for effective load distribution. Guidelines recommend that ties be spaced at intervals of no more than 900 mm vertically and 450 mm horizontally, though this may vary based on local building codes. 2. Type of Tie Choosing the correct type of wall tie is essential. Factors such as the building design, exposure conditions, and internal environmental factors (like humidity) can influence this decision. 3. Tie Length The length of the wall tie should be adequate to reach across the cavity, with a minimum embedment into both the inner and outer walls to ensure a secure connection. 4. Corrosion Resistance This is particularly important in coastal or industrial areas where exposure to salt or chemicals is higher. Using stainless steel or other corrosion-resistant materials can prolong the life of the ties and the wall. 5. Regular Inspection Like any structural component, wall ties should be inspected regularly to ensure they are intact and functioning properly. Signs of failure include bulging walls, cracks, or visible deterioration of the ties themselves.
